    If you can get to level 100, it could be worth it for the extra relic. You don't get relics from level 10-70 but you'll get to 80 a lot faster with the artifacts' extra power! The next time you prestige, you'll be at a lot higher stages, very likely.

    Edit: and your cash will reset. So spend as much gold as you can for the prestige bonuses.

    Money and Tips

    I just spent two hours crunching some numbers to see if it's better to level up weaker characters or to only hire stronger ones, using the sequential heroes Milo and Clonk-Clonk (MaCC), Macelord, Gertrude, Twitterella, Master Hawk, and Elpha. My brain is a little fried, so I don't want to make any recommendations. Here are the findings:

    Once hired, the cost of getting Milo and Clonk-Clonk up to Lv 10 is $1.88B. For that money, you gain 78M DPS.

    Once hired, the cost of getting Macelord up to Lv 10 is $12.35B. For that money, you gain 324M DPS. You spent 6.5x more money than on MaCC to gain 4.2x the damage. That’s not so fair.

    Once hired, the cost of getting Gertrude up to Lv 10 is $89.8B. For that money, you gain 1.7B DPS. You spent 7.2x more money than on Macelord to gain 5.2x the damage. That’s a little better, but still not so hot.

    Once hired, the cost of getting Twiterella up to Lv 10 is $711B. For that money, you gain 6.2B DPS. You spent 7.9x more money than on Macelord to gain 3.65x the damage. Unless the coin rate climbed significantly after Gertrude (which is impossible to know, as coin rate depends on what Stage Number you're on and how lucky you get with the Fairy presents), that's highway robbery.

    So, recap: you spent almost $1T hiring and leveling up (to Lv 10) the heroes Macc, Macelord, Gertrude, and Twitterella. For that money and time, you gained about 10B DPS.

    On to Master Hawk. Once hired, the cost of getting Master Hawk up to Lv 10 is $10.7T. For that money, you gain 48.9B DPS. You spent 15x more money than on Twiterella to gain 7.9x the damage. That's really bad, unless the coin rate doubles during this time.

    By now, you've spent almost $12T hiring and leveling up (to Lv 10) the heroes Macc, Macelord, Gertrude, Twitterella, and Master Hawk. For that money and time, you gained about 60B DPS, mostly from Master Hawk.

    It costs $8.2T to hire Elpha, and you gain 24.4B DPS.

    ---

    Honestly, it's still unclear to me which route is better. There doesn't seem to be any rhyme or reason to the algorithms. I don't know if the pattern holds true with every block of heroes, or if it holds across all levels beyond 10, or what.

    For now, I'm sticking with this:

    1) Prioritize hiring a stronger hero then leveling any weaker ones--unless you're stuck and can't beat a boss (in which case, level up a hero with a boss damage-enhancing skill).

    2) Only level up a hero if that hero has a gold-enhancing skill within your reach (i.e., if you can unlock that skill sooner than you can hire the next available hero)

    3) Don't level ANYONE past 400 (h/t to Reddit). The returns on that are unjustifiable.

    4) To farm gold, wait for the fairy present Ultimate Hand of Midas, then activate the Power of Holding (50 gems). A Clone doesn't create actual taps, but the Power of Holding does--a whopping 30 per second. So with the Ultimate Hand of Midas gift (which lasts about 16 seconds), you'll rack up insane amounts of gold. Once the Ultimate Touch of Midas gift runs out, activate your main hero's Midas Touch skill to keep the fun going. This is a great way to make INSANE amounts of money, especially on later levels.

    5) Rather than spending 100 gems on instant gold, try the trick for #4 above. You'll make more money this way and can use two Power of Holdings instead

    6) If a boss is giving you trouble, wait around for a fairy present that gives you 2x Attack Speed or a Clone, then hit "Fight Boss" and stack one of your main hero's main skills

    7) Guardian Shield is totally worth it

    8) When you activate the Prestige skill (at Hero Lv 600), you keep both your relics and your artifacts, and the game restarts. Before you confirm that you want to Prestige, the game will award you anywhere from 3-12 bonus relics, depending on how strong you are and how many Stages you've reached. Since you gain one relic per 10 stages after Stage 80, it pays to hold off on Prestiging until at least Stage 90 or 100.

    @Cyg: This... And DO NOT LEVEL UP YOUR CHARACTER Past lv600. You scale more from upgrading your heroes instead. If it's your first prestige, i suggest trying to extend to stage 100 first for the extra relics. They are awesome!

    Im on my 4th prestige now and it takes about an hour to get to stage150. I always prestige at 300 right now. Past that, the grind slows down significantly, so i prestige to gain over 200 relics and power up the artifacts.
